Detathmatch goodies in single player mode are not deterministic

samboy opened this issue · 2 comments

Description of problem

The detathmatch goodies in single player mode move around if we make the same megawad multiple times without closing the ObHack GUI between making megawads.

Steps to reproduce

  • Enter the ObHack-engine-697 directory
  • Edit scripts/writer.lua to change if false to if true (enable debug mode)
  • Remove the file CONFIG.cfg
  • Open up ObHack (or ObHack.exe in Windows)
  • Generate a map. ObHack will report an error; this is to be expected (since we altered writer.lua)
  • The SHA-256 sum of MAP12.txt will be 24cee2c01ca49322cb18795c788374598ebe25a0b26b890211a356ed17ee6954
  • Generate a map again
  • Look at the SHA-256 sum of MAP12.txt
  • Be sure to restore writer.lua to its previous state. This can be verified with git status

Expected results

The SHA-256 sum of MAP12.txt should be 24cee2c01ca49322cb18795c788374598ebe25a0b26b890211a356ed17ee6954 again

Actual results

The SHA-256 sum of MAP12.txt is something different, such as 17300c2079cabc831eb097855cfa1c35c2f85d4d19ad9813a6fceb928eac9016
